Here it is 1/2 hour before sunrise to 1/2 hour after sunset. It was 1/2 hour after sunrise and 1/2 hour before sunset but, that wasn changed a few years ago. The first year it was changed we did have one fatality as a result of an overcast evening as a storm was moving in. as always it is sad when anything like that happens. So always be sure of your target before you shoot please.

Sorry, but wrong. The question asked is about Gun hunting. Bow it is half hour before and after, but gun it is half hour before to sunset. I hate having to stop at sunset when gun hunting, I wish I did not have to. But I know they do it for our protection from like you said, to many people would shoot at blobs moving at 100 yards!
